This is like the foundation of good maintenance. You gotta check your machinery regularly to catch any issues before they turn into big problems. I&#8217;m not just talking about a quick once-over every now and then. I mean a thorough inspection, looking at all the parts, checking for wear and tear, loose bolts, and any signs of damage. You can set up a schedule for these inspections, like once a week or once a month, depending on how often you use the machinery.<\/p>\n<p>When you&#8217;re doing these inspections, pay special attention to the moving parts. The gears, bearings, and chains are all critical components that can wear out quickly if not properly maintained. Look for any signs of excessive wear, like grooves or cracks. If you notice anything off, don&#8217;t wait to fix it. A small problem now can turn into a major breakdown later, which will cost you a fortune to repair.<\/p>\n<p>Another important thing is lubrication. You gotta keep those moving parts well-lubricated to reduce friction and wear. Use the right type of lubricant for your machinery, and make sure you apply it at the right intervals. Over-lubricating can be just as bad as under-lubricating, so follow the manufacturer&#8217;s recommendations. And don&#8217;t forget to clean the lubrication points regularly to prevent dirt and debris from getting in.<\/p>\n<p>Proper storage is also key. When your steel formwork machinery isn&#8217;t in use, you need to store it in a dry, clean place. Moisture and dirt can cause rust and corrosion, which will not only damage the machinery but also increase the maintenance cost. If possible, cover the machinery with a tarp or other protective covering to keep it clean and dry.<\/p>\n<p>Training your operators is another great way to reduce maintenance costs. Make sure your operators know how to use the machinery properly. Improper use can cause unnecessary wear and tear on the equipment. Teach them the correct operating procedures, safety guidelines, and how to do basic maintenance tasks like cleaning and lubrication. A well-trained operator can spot potential problems early on and take the necessary steps to prevent them from getting worse.<\/p>\n<p>Now, let&#8217;s talk about spare parts. Having the right spare parts on hand can save you a lot of time and money. When a part breaks down, you don&#8217;t want to wait weeks for a replacement to arrive. Keep an inventory of the most common spare parts for your steel formwork machinery. But don&#8217;t go overboard and stockpile a whole bunch of parts that you may never use. Just focus on the essentials.<\/p>\n<p>And when you do need to replace a part, make sure you&#8217;re getting a high-quality replacement. Don&#8217;t skimp on the parts just to save a few bucks. Cheap parts may seem like a good deal at first, but they often don&#8217;t last as long and can cause more problems in the long run. Invest in quality parts that are designed to fit your machinery perfectly.<\/p>\n<p>Regular cleaning is also crucial. Dirt, dust, and debris can build up on your machinery over time, which can affect its performance and increase the risk of breakdowns. Clean your machinery after each use, or at least on a regular basis. Use the right cleaning tools and products to avoid damaging the equipment.<\/p>\n<p>And don&#8217;t forget about software updates if your machinery has any electronic components. Manufacturers often release updates to improve performance, fix bugs, and add new features. Keeping your software up to date can help prevent problems and ensure that your machinery is running at its best.<\/p>\n<p>Finally, consider partnering with a reliable maintenance service provider. A professional maintenance team can help you keep your machinery in top condition. They have the expertise and tools to perform in-depth inspections, diagnose problems, and make repairs quickly and efficiently. They can also provide you with valuable advice on how to reduce maintenance costs in the long term.<\/p>\n<p>In conclusion, reducing the maintenance cost of your steel formwork machinery is all about being proactive. Regular inspections, proper lubrication, good storage, operator training, having the right spare parts, cleaning, software updates, and partnering with a maintenance service provider are all important steps you can take.
